Summary
The Human Resources Director will serve as a generalist, functioning for the Jacksonville region. Main focus will be to work with regional leadership team, managers and employees to create and sustain a highly engaged and enabled work environment. This position is both a strategic and hands-on role that provides full cycle employee experience and support in executing our people initiatives.
Duties/Responsibilities
Serve as a credible and trustworthy advocate representing/addressing the needs and concerns of the office and to be able to ensure/measure alignment around business needs.
Ensures necessary administrative tasks are managed in a timely fashion with a high level of accuracy (HRIS entries, Leave Administration, New Hire and Termination paperwork, etc.).
Conducts new employee processes; writing offer letters, performing background checks and on-boarding employees.
Conduct bi-weekly payroll.
Handles discipline and termination of employees in accordance with company policy constructive, and when needed properly offboard people. May be required to administer and execute routine tasks in delicate circumstances such as providing reasonable accommodations, investigating allegations of wrongdoing, and terminations.
Serve as culture liaison, planning local events and charity functions.
Maintains comp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ations, and recommended best practices; reviews policies and practices to maintain compliance.
Maintains knowledge of trends, best practices, regulatory changes, and new technologies in human resources, talent management, and employment law.
Required Skills/Experience
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field required.
A minimum of 7+ years of human resource management experience preferred.
Excellent interpersonal, negotiation, and conflict resolution skills.
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ail.
Ability to act with integrity, professionalism, and confidentiality.
Thorough knowledge of employment-related laws and regulations.
Proficient with Microsoft Office Suite or related software.

E-Verify
This employer participates in E-Verify and will provide the federal government with your Form I-9 information to confirm that you are authorized to work in the U.S. If E-Verify cannot confirm that you are authorized to work, this employer is required to give you written instructions and an opportunity to contact Department of Homeland Security (DHS) or Social Security Administration (SSA) so you can begin to resolve the issue before the employer can take any action against you, including terminating your employment. Employers can only use E-Verify once you have accepted a job offer and completed the I-9 Form.
